WebMar 24, 2024 · The Wolfram Language can solve cubic equations exactly using the built-in command Solve [ a3 x^3 + a2 x^2 + a1 x + a0 == 0, x ]. The solution can also be expressed in terms of the Wolfram Language algebraic root objects by first issuing SetOptions [ Roots , Cubics -> False ]. Solve [ expr, vars, dom] solves over the domain dom. … track light ceiling designWebApr 20, 2024 · The Riemann zeta function ζ(s) is defined for all complex numbers s ≠ 1. It has zeros at the negative even integers (i.e. at s = − 2, − 4, − 6,...). These are called the trivial zeros.
